A new study warns that a 100-foot tsunami from a Cascadia megathrust earthquake could devastate the US Pacific Northwest and parts of Canada within decades. Triggered by a fault off the West Coast, the event could cause over 13,000 deaths, $134 billion in damages, and permanently reshape coastlines—especially as rising sea levels worsen the impact.
